1 Bridge Planning Layout Tools
Horizontal Alignment Tool BGrade Elevation View Plot Tool Bridge Fill Plot Tool Bridge RPW Plot Tool Bridge Planning – integrate gradeline, elevation view, site plan Tools – computer vs. manual – calculations, drafting – many options, modifications

2 Horizontal Alignment Tool
Horizontal Alignment Tool – generate geo-referenced coordinates for spiral/simple curves between 2 tangents Tangents defined by 3 points – export from Global Mapper Enter R, A, STA? Spiral and Simple curve data are calculated and plotted Export file prepared – Global Mapper

3 Horizontal Alignment Tool
Horizontal Alignment Tool – generate geo-referenced coordinates for spiral/simple curves between 2 tangents Excel plot to confirm inputs Shows key geometry data Note Simple vs. spiral – similar alignment, different length

4 Horizontal Alignment Tool
BF76474 – Smoky River near Grande Cache, Hwy 40 : Possible realignment option – R1500, R2000 spirals R2000 – near upper limit for fit Both difficult stream crossing locations, horrendous gradelines (150m high bridge)

5 Horizontal Alignment Tool
BF76474 – Smoky River near Grande Cache, Hwy 40 : Possible realignment option – R600 (110km/hr), R440 (100 km/hr) spirals – existing is R ~ 400m Tangent set to match existing highway with 15 – 20m shift d/s at bridge R600 doesn’t quite fit, big campground impact R440 fits

6 BGrade Graphically move VPI to match Ground Line

7 BGrade Data Screen – red values are inputs, blue are calculated
STA, EL can be entered or changed from Plot Note – G, K, Overlap, Bridge (EL, G), Cut/Fill

8 BGrade Detailed Output along vertical curves, EL, G

9 BGrade Plot multiple gradelines for comparison

10 Elevation View Plot Paste in XS, GL data
Enter basic opening data and typical rock protection data Try range of STA values

11 Elevation View Plot Base Elevation View plot is automatically updated.
Plots GL, headslopes, and rock.

12 Elevation View Plot Plot can be stretched to mimic natural scale in Excel. Plot can be zoomed in on in Excel.
